How Stainless Steel Skeleton Design Improves TPE Torso Product Quality
For realistic TPE products, the external appearance is only one part of the design.
The internal skeleton structure plays an equally important role in product stability, flexibility, durability, and overall user experience.

Why Internal Skeleton Design Matters for TPE Products
TPE is widely used in realistic products because of its soft touch and flexible characteristics.
However, larger and heavier products require stronger internal support to maintain structural stability.
A well-designed skeleton system helps:
- Improve overall support
- Maintain product shape
- Provide controlled movement
- Reduce stress on soft TPE material
- Improve long-term durability
For different product sizes and weights, the skeleton structure needs to be customized accordingly.
Stainless Steel Skeleton for Better Strength and Durability
For our TPE torso projects, stainless steel is selected as the main skeleton material because of its:
- High strength
- Good durability
- Corrosion resistance
- Stable performance
Compared with lighter structures, reinforced stainless steel skeleton solutions are more suitable for larger products that require additional support.

Protective Design to Reduce Material Damage Risk
One important consideration in TPE product manufacturing is protecting the soft outer material from internal structures.
Sharp edges or exposed metal parts may create unnecessary risks during assembly, transportation, or long-term use.
To improve safety, our skeleton structures use protective wrapping around the metal frame.
This helps:
- Reduce direct contact between metal and TPE material
- Lower the risk of puncturing soft materials
- Improve product reliability
For larger products, especially heavier designs, additional attention is required during structural planning to ensure the balance between flexibility and protection.
